http://www.cyworld.com/billog/3152025 에서 퍼옴

[ Drive Object Property ]

Drive 개체의 속성
AvailableSpace 지정한 드라이브나 네트워크 공유에서 사용할 수 있는 디스크 공간의 크기를 반환
DriveLetter 실제의 로컬 드라이브나 네트워크 공유의 드라이브 문자를 반환
FileSystem 드라이브에서 사용하는 파일 시스템의 형식을 반환(FAT, NTFS 및 CDFS)
FreeSpace 지정한 드라이브나 네트워크 공유에서 사용할 수 있는 빈 공간 크기를 반환
IsReady 지정한 드라이브가 준비되었으면 True를, 그렇지 않으면 False를 반환
Path 지정한 파일, 폴더 또는 드라이브의 경로를 반환
RootFolder 지정한 드라이브의 루트 폴더를 나타내는 Folder 개체를 반환
SerialNumber 디스크 볼륨을 고유하게 식별하는 데 사용하는 십진 일련 번호를 반환
ShareName 지정한 드라이브의 네트워크 공유 이름을 반환
TotalSize 드라이브나 네트워크 공유의 전체 공간을 바이트 단위로 반환
VolumeName 지정한 드라이브의 볼륨 이름을 지정하거나 반환
<%
Set fs = Server.CreateObject("Scripting.FileSystemObject")
Set Cdrive = fs.GetDrive("c:")
%>
<HTML>
<BODY>
<br><center><font face="돋움" size="2">
<h2>FileSystemObject Ex1</h2><br>
C드라이브의 남은 공간 : <%=Cdrive.freespace%> bytes
</font></center>
</BODY>
</HTML>

 

 

[ File Object Property ]

File 개체의 속성

Size

파일의 사이즈를 얻어옵니다.

Type

파일의 타입을 얻어옵니다.

Path

파일의 경로를 반환함다

ShortName

파일의 이름를 8.3규칙으로 반환함다

ShortPath

파일의 경로을 8.3규칙으로 반환함다

ParentFolder

파일의 상위 폴더를 얻어옵니다.

Name

파일의 이름을 얻어옵니다

Drive

파일이 위치하는 드라이브명을 얻어옵니다

DateCreated

파일이 만들어진 날짜와 시간을 얻어옵니다
DateLastAccessed 파일이 마지막으로 억세스된 날짜,시간을 반환
DateLastModified 파일이 마지막으로 수정된 날짜,시간을 반환

<%
Set fs = Server.CreateObject("Scripting.FileSystemObject")
Set myfile = fs.GetFile("c:\config.sys")
%>
<HTML>
<BODY>
<br><center><font face="돋움" size="2">
<h2>FileSystemObject 예제</h2>
Config.sys 화일의 정보<p>
file size : <%=myfile.size%> bytes<br>
file type : <%=myfile.type%><br>
file path : <%=myfile.path%>
</font></center>
</BODY>
</HTML>

 



http://naradesign.net/open_content/lecture/wp/


https://www.youtube.com/watch?v=e0fu2Kg5DMo